Season 2 Episodes

S02 Episode 1

Resolutions

Jenna avoids dealing with the revelation that her mum wrote the confrontation letter, until Jake's holiday gift forces her to decide whether she's ready to leave her past with Matty behind for good.

22 mins  ·  Thu, 28 Jun 2012

S02 Episode 2

Sex, Lies and the Sanctuary

Finally officially with Jake, Jenna revels in her new relationship status until she hears about the hidden camera that has been filming at the Sanctuary for months. She then goes to great lengths to destroy the tape.

21 mins  ·  Thu, 5 Jul 2012

S02 Episode 3

Three's a Crowd

While trying to make nice with Matty and please Jake, Jenna struggles to ignore Matty's ongoing flirtatious efforts and clingy behaviour.

21 mins  ·  Thu, 12 Jul 2012

S02 Episode 4

Are You There God? It's Me, Jenna

Still reeling from her parents separation, Jenna feels responsible. In an impulsive effort to absolve herself, she seeks refuge from her problems in a higher power at church camp.

21 mins  ·  Thu, 19 Jul 2012

S02 Episode 5

My Love Is a Black Heart

As Jenna prepares to spend her first Valentine's Day with a boyfriend, both she and Tamara become jealous as they confront the possibility that their exes are moving on without them.

20 mins  ·  Thu, 26 Jul 2012

S02 Episode 6

What Comes First: Sex or Love?

Still reeling from Jake's proclamation of love, Jenna tries to figure out if having sex with Jake will bring her some clarity about her own feelings.

21 mins  ·  Thu, 2 Aug 2012

S02 Episode 7

Another One Bites the Dust

Now clear on her feelings for Jake, Jenna has to do the deed. Her determination, however, is met with obstacles in the form of Aunt Ally's wedding, a man from her mother's past, and a scheming Sadie.

21 mins  ·  Thu, 9 Aug 2012

S02 Episode 8

Time After Time

A series of bad timing and revelations leave Jenna and Jake both devastated.

21 mins  ·  Thu, 16 Aug 2012

S02 Episode 9

Homewrecker Hamilton

Haunted by her break-up and make-up with the boys, Jenna privately struggles with how to untangle her twisted love life, until an unexpected text brings all her drama to the spotlight.

20 mins  ·  Thu, 23 Aug 2012

S02 Episode 10

Pick Me, Choose Me, Love Me

In the aftermath of releasing her blog, everyone seems to have an opinion about Jenna's life, but while everyone else is in it for the entertainment, Jake and Matty want answers.

21 mins  ·  Thu, 30 Aug 2012

S02 Episode 11

Once Upon a Blog

Jenna's imagination runs wild as she fictionalises her blog in an attempt to change her fate. In their reimagination and examination of her past, Jenna attempts to figure out her future.

20 mins  ·  Thu, 13 Sep 2012

S02 Episode 12

The Other Shoe

Jenna's decision about the boys goes public. Combined with a trip to Europe, everything is seeming to go Jenna's way.

Got a question about Foxtel Now?

You can have up to five devices registered to use Foxtel Now at any one time, and you can stream on any two of those at the same time. You can remove and add devices to the list as often as you like.
Unlike some other streaming services, Foxtel Now’s mobile apps don’t allow downloading content for offline viewing. However, almost all shows seen on Foxtel Now’s channels can be streamed on demand at any time.
While you can watch your Foxtel Now channels anywhere in Australia – making it the ideal TV service for frequent travellers – because of rights restrictions it can’t be used while you’re overseas. If you’re travelling outside Australia for an extended period, you can pause your subscription.

Got a question about Paramount Plus?

At launch, Paramount+ features a large library of shows, including many that are exclusive to the service, such as “Why Women Kill”. It also features content from Network Ten, such as Australian Survivor and the latest season of the hit “Five Bedrooms,” and hundreds of movies. It will also be the new home of A-League soccer from the 2021 season onwards.
With so many streaming services around, value is essential – and so Paramount+ pricing its monthly subscription at only $8.99 is a definite winner, putting it well below the prices asked by other streaming services. You can also opt for an annual subscription, which costs $89.99 – effectively giving you two months of the year free, reducing the monthly cost to $7.50.
At launch, there are apps available for Apple TV (including the old Apple TV 3), Android TV (including Sony smart TVs and Google’s latest Chromecast) and iOS and Android phones and tablets. There is also support for smart TVs from LG and Samsung, but only for models made after 2018.
